Background
The construction waste refers to the general name of dregs, waste concrete, waste bricks and stones and other wastes generated in the production activities of people in the construction industry such as demolition, construction, decoration and repair. At present, due to the rapid development of the construction industry, the construction waste brings great environmental problems and resource waste, and how to properly treat the construction waste becomes a problem which is more concerned by the society.
However, the traditional construction waste treatment device is simple in structure, is not reasonable in design, cannot sort, reject, crush and reuse renewable resources in construction waste, is complex in traditional construction waste treatment method, poor in treatment effect, low in working efficiency, too high in cost for treating construction waste, and is not suitable for popularization and use in the market.

Detailed Description
The technical solutions in the embodiments of the present invention will be described clearly and completely with reference to the accompanying drawings in the embodiments of the present invention, and it is obvious that the described embodiments are only some embodiments of the present invention, not all embodiments. Based on the embodiments in the present invention, all other embodiments obtained by a person skilled in the art without creative work belong to the protection scope of the present invention.
Referring to fig. 1-3, the present invention provides a technical solution: a construction waste treatment device comprises a machine shell 2, a base 13 is arranged at the bottom of the machine shell 2, a feed inlet 6 is arranged at the top of the machine shell 2, the lower end of the feed inlet 6 is connected with a collecting and compressing device 4 through a feed corrugated pipe 5, a telescopic motor is arranged inside the collecting and compressing device 4, an output shaft of the telescopic motor is connected with a pressing plate, a hydraulic telescopic device 15 is arranged at one side of the collecting and compressing device 4, the top end of the hydraulic telescopic device 15 is connected with the bottom end of the feed inlet 6, the bottom end of the hydraulic telescopic device 15 is fixed on a support frame 11, a conveying device 12 is arranged at one side of the support frame 11, an inlet of the conveying device 12 is communicated with a discharge port of the collecting and compressing device 4, an auger for conveying waste is arranged inside the conveying device 12, a motor for the auger is arranged at one end of the auger, the crushing device 1 is provided with crushing blades 20, the lower ends of the crushing blades 20 are provided with crushing plates 19 with grooves, the crushing device 1 is internally provided with a motor, an output shaft of the motor is connected with the crushing blades 21, the motor is arranged in a clamping device 22, the crushing blades 21 are fixedly connected with a rotating disc 26 through the clamping device 22, the crushing plates 19 are fixedly connected with scraping plates 24 through fixing screws 18, one side of the crushing device 1 is provided with a piston rod 23 for dredging and blocking, one end of the piston rod 23 is provided with the scraping plate 24, the scraping plate 24 is fixedly clamped with the piston rod 23 through a positioning pin 16, the rear end of the piston rod 23 is provided with a hydraulic cylinder 17, the front end of the piston rod 23 is correspondingly provided with a dredging hole 14, the lower end of the crushing device 1 is provided with a third discharge hole 25, the lower end of the third discharge hole 25 is correspondingly, the lower end of the vibrator 8 is provided with a conveying belt 9, and the discharging pipe 7 is shaken by the vibrator 8, so that the discharging pipe 7 is prevented from being blocked.
The working principle is as follows: when the construction waste treatment device is used, firstly, a feeding hopper 6 is lifted through a hydraulic expansion device 15, after the construction waste to be treated is adjusted to a proper position, the construction waste to be treated is poured from the feeding hopper 6 and falls into a collecting and compressing device 4 through a feeding corrugated pipe 6, a telescopic motor electric pressing plate of the collecting and compressing device 4 is used for extruding the falling construction waste, then the extruded construction waste enters a conveying device 12, a motor in the conveying device 12 is used for driving a packing auger to stir and convey the pressed construction waste, then the construction waste enters a crushing device 1 through a first discharge port 3, at the moment, the motor in the crushing device 1 drives a crushing blade 21 to rotate, the construction waste is cut and crushed by matching with a crushing plate 19, if the construction waste is blocked in the construction waste, a hydraulic cylinder 17 can be started to work to drive a piston rod 23 to expand and contract, and a scraping plate 24 at the end of the piston rod 23 is movably driven to dredge the blocked construction waste, and pushing out the blocked construction waste from the dredging opening 14, enabling the crushed construction waste to fall into the material distributing opening 10 through the second material outlet 25, conveying the crushed construction waste to the conveyor belt 9 through the plurality of material outlet pipes 7, and outputting the crushed construction waste by using the conveyor belt 9, thereby finishing the treatment work of the construction waste.
